Qatar Airways denied boarding to infant despite issuing pass; court awards Rs 10 lakh

Middle East 1 source 1 country 🔦 Under-reported 23m ago

A Kerala consumer commission ordered Qatar Airways to pay ten lakh rupees compensation. The airline denied boarding to two children, including an infant, despite issuing boarding passes. This action was deemed a deficiency in service and unfair trade practice by the commission.

The family suffered significant mental agony and hardship due to the airline's arbitrary decision. Qatar Airways must comply with the order within forty-five days.
